Re-Volt tarzı küçük oyun yapmak

Katılım
1 Aralık 2019
Mesajlar
2.122
Çözümler
6
Daha fazla  
Cinsiyet
Erkek
Arkadaşlar, yaklaşık 10-12 sene önce Re-Volt oynardım. Bilen çok kişi olmasa da küçük RC arabaların yarışı oyunu, 1999 yapımı bir oyun. Bu tarz küçük oyunları kodlamak istiyorum. Bunları nasıl yapabilirim? Bilmeyenler için Re-Volt - Wikipedia,

Bu içeriği görüntülemek için üçüncü taraf çerezlerini yerleştirmek için izninize ihtiyacımız olacak.
Daha detaylı bilgi için, çerezler sayfamıza bakınız.


Video ve Wikipedia yazısını bıraktım.
 
Son düzenleyen: Moderatör:
Eski olması oyunu basit yapmaz. O tip bir oyunu 0 deneyim ve tek kişi ile yapmanız yıllar alabilir.

Ki Re-Volt hiç de küçük bir oyun değil. Küçük olarak adlandırabileceğiniz oyunlar, genelde mobil platformlara çıkan "Hyper Casual" olarak geçen "az vasıflı" oyunlardır.
 
Oyun motoru kullanmadan yapabilirsin ve bu seni çok çok ileri taşır. OpenGL veya SFML ile yapılabilir fakat iyi bir matematik ve büyük bir süre lazım yapmak için. Bence sadece bir seviyeyi bile yapman seni gayet iyi yapar programlama konusunda.
Bana tek bölüm bile yapmak yeter sadece günümüzde de oynanabilecek olmasını istiyorum artık unutulan oyunlardan biri.
Oyun motoru kullanmadan yapabilirsin ve bu seni çok çok ileri taşır. OpenGL veya SFML ile yapılabilir fakat iyi bir matematik ve büyük bir süre lazım yapmak için. Bence sadece bir seviyeyi bile yapman seni gayet iyi yapar programlama konusunda.

Udemy üzerinden Unreal Engine kursu alın. Yol uzun ve meşakkatli, başlangıç bu olabilir.

Benim için Udemy kullanmak mı yoksa oyun motoru kullanmadan yapmak seçeneklerinden hangisi daha kolay olur. Kodlamada çok bilgili değilim.
 
Son düzenleme:
Bana tek bölüm bile yapmak yeter sadece günümüzde de oynanabilecek olmasını istiyorum artık unutulan oyunlardan biri.

Benim için Udemy kullanmak mı yoksa oyun motoru kullanmadan yapmak seçeneklerinden hangisi daha kolay olur. Kodlamada çok bilgili değilim.

Öncesinde de dediğim gibi, yol uzun ve meşakkatli. Siz Udemy üzerinden Unreal kursu alıp bakın bir, sonra başarıp başarmayacağınızı az çok anlarsınız. Kod yazmak ve OpenGL muhabbetleri; bırakın sizi, piyasada "yazılımcı" kimliği taşıyan profesyonel (profesyonel = bu işten para kazanan) kişilerin bile üstesinden gelebileceği işler değil. Bunun modellemesi var, renklendirmesi(texture mapping), remesh(High poly-Low poly) olayı var, oyun motoru olayı var, map tasarım olayı var, Blueprint hazırlaması var, sounds olayı var... Var babam var. Sadece harita tasarımı için 2 sene boyunca sürekli harita tasarımı yapan insanlar var.
Size tavsiyem en geniş açıdan olayı bir görün, boğulup boğulmayacağınıza karar verdikten sonra bismillah der suya girersiniz 😉😁. Kolay gelsin.
 
Son düzenleme:
Öncesinde de dediğim gibi, yol uzun ve meşakkatli. Siz Udemy üzerinden Unreal kursu alıp bakın bir, sonra başarıp başarmayacağınızı az çok anlarsınız. Kod yazmak ve OpenCL muhabbetleri; bırakın sizi, piyasada "yazılımcı" kimliği taşıyan profesyonel (profesyonel = bu işten para kazanan) kişilerin bile üstesinden gelebileceği işler değil. Bunun modellemesi var, renklendirmesi(texture mapping), remesh(High poly-Low poly) olayı var, oyun motoru olayı var, map tasarım olayı var, Blueprint hazırlaması var, sounds olayı var... Var babam var. Sadece harita tasarımı için 2 sene boyunca sürekli harita tasarımı yapan insanlar var.
Size tavsiyem en geniş açıdan olayı bir görün, boğulup boğulmayacağınıza karar verdikten sonra bismillah der suya girersiniz 😉😁. Kolay gelsin.
Emin misin? Ayrıca OpenCL'den bahsetmedim, OpenGL, grafik kütüphanesi olan.

Yurt dışında öğrencilere bilgisayar grafikleri dersinde okul projesi olarak veriliyor OpenGL ile bir oyun yapmak, bu saydıklarının çoğunu yapıyor öğrenciler belirli bir sürede ve teslim ediyorlar. Arkadaşın gelişimi açısından çok güzel bir şey olacağı için söyledim.

Oyun motoru dediğimiz şey, oyunlarda kullanılan ortak şeylerin bir araya toplandığı bir framework'tür. Bilgisayar grafikleri hakkında teorik bilgiye sahip olmak, oyun motoru kullanmayı kolaylaştıran bir etkendir çünkü o framework'te nelerin olduğunu bilirsin. Motor komponentleri böyle işliyor. Oyun programlama sadece Udemy kursu alarak yapılacak bir şey değildir, iyi bir matematik olmazsa üstesinden zor gelinir.
 
Emin misin? Ayrıca OpenCL'den bahsetmedim, OpenGL, grafik kütüphanesi olan.

Yurt dışında öğrencilere bilgisayar grafikleri dersinde okul projesi olarak veriliyor OpenGL ile bir oyun yapmak, bu saydıklarının çoğunu yapıyor öğrenciler belirli bir sürede ve teslim ediyorlar. Arkadaşın gelişimi açısından çok güzel bir şey olacağı için söyledim.

Oyun motoru dediğimiz şey, oyunlarda kullanılan ortak şeylerin bir araya toplandığı bir framework'tür. Bilgisayar grafikleri hakkında teorik bilgiye sahip olmak, oyun motoru kullanmayı kolaylaştıran bir etkendir çünkü o framework'te nelerin olduğunu bilirsin. Motor komponentleri böyle işliyor. Oyun programlama sadece Udemy kursu alarak yapılacak bir şey değildir, iyi bir matematik olmazsa üstesinden zor gelinir.
Hocam belirtmek isterim ki sizinle af buyurun amiyane tabirle "sidik yarıştırdığım" falan yok. OpenGL yazmam lazımdı, yanlış yazmışım. Kod yazmayı bilmeyen bir arkadaşa işin aslında ne kadar büyük ve karmaşık olduğunu en kolay ve öğretici ;ve en önemlisi "sıkmadan" yapmanın yolunun öncesinde verdiğim cevap olduğunu düşünüyorum.
Herkes kendi fikrini söylemekte özgürdür elbette, kod yazabilir. Ne kadar başarılı olur orası meçhul...
 
Hocam belirtmek isterim ki sizinle af buyurun amiyane tabirle "sidik yarıştırdığım" falan yok. OpenGL yazmam lazımdı, yanlış yazmışım. Kod yazmayı bilmeyen bir arkadaşa işin aslında ne kadar büyük ve karmaşık olduğunu en kolay ve öğretici ;ve en önemlisi "sıkmadan" yapmanın yolunun öncesinde verdiğim cevap olduğunu düşünüyorum.
Herkes kendi fikrini söylemekte özgürdür elbette, kod yazabilir. Ne kadar başarılı olur orası meçhul...
Estağfirullah, bilgi kirliliği olmaması adına yazıyorum ben de. Bir yandan da kendi fikirlerimi beyan ediyorum.
 
Uyarı! Bu konu 5 yıl önce açıldı.
Muhtemelen daha fazla tartışma gerekli değildir ki bu durumda yeni bir konu başlatmayı öneririz. Eğer yine de cevabınızın gerekli olduğunu düşünüyorsanız buna rağmen cevap verebilirsiniz.

Bu konuyu görüntüleyen kullanıcılar

Technopat Haberler

Yeni konular

Geri
Yukarı